Yes as an alternative you might just add the envelope first (and it get added at current parameter value) and THEN start writing/latching/whatever so that it doesn't get crated at the WRONG default value
@Devs: I think this is quite a usability quirk the I ask you please to address. IS SUM: When envelopes get automatically created during WRITE by adjusting a parameter, the envelope get created at Default level rather than current one
-----------------
Just an anectode that explain why this behavior is unwanted:
Yesterday I got in Write mode with FabFilter ProQ2 EQ, started touching a band at 1500hz and inadvertently moved not only the gain but also the frequency. A frequency envelope was created at the standard value of (ouch!) 300hz... so out of the interval where I adjusted the parameter all was set at 300HZ...
